Bug 166741 - plasma workspace crash after changing plasma theme
Summary: plasma workspace crash after changing plasma theme
Status: RESOLVED FIXED
Alias: None
Product: plasma4
Classification: Unmaintained
Component: general (show other bugs)
Version: unspecified
Platform: Compiled Sources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2008-07-16 17:03 UTC by SlashDevDsp
Modified: 2008-07-17 04:04 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description SlashDevDsp 2008-07-16 17:03:17 UTC
Version:            (using Devel)
Installed from:    Compiled sources
Compiler:          g++ (GCC) 4.1.3 20070929 (prerelease) (Ubuntu 4.1.2-16ubuntu2) 
OS:                Linux

Was downloading new plasma themes to try out, downloaded a few and installed and applied the themes. then suddenly plasma crashed. attached backtrace.
hth
Application: Plasma Workspace (plasma), signal SIGSEGV
Using host libthread_db library "/lib/tls/i686/cmov/libthread_db.so.1".
[New Thread -1263552800 (LWP 28347)]
[New Thread -1340421232 (LWP 28608)]
[New Thread -1319249008 (LWP 28596)]
[New Thread -1302393968 (LWP 28349)]
[New Thread -1293800560 (LWP 28348)]
[Current thread is 0 (LWP 28347)]

Thread 5 (Thread -1293800560 (LWP 28348)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b6831676 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b6894a06 in QWaitCondition::wait (this=0x81afaf8, mutex=0x81afaf4, time=4294967295)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qwaitcondition_unix.cpp:88
#3  0xb6002e6d in QHostInfoAgent::run (this=0x81afae8) at /home/kde-devel/kdesvn/qt-copy/src/network/kernel/qhostinfo.cpp:247
#4  0xb6894327 in QThreadPrivate::start (arg=0x81afae8)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qthread_unix.cpp:190
#5  0xb682d46b in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#6  0xb5c736de in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 4 (Thread -1302393968 (LWP 28349)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b6831676 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b6894a06 in QWaitCondition::wait (this=0x817601c, mutex=0x8176018, time=4294967295)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qwaitcondition_unix.cpp:88
#3  0xb2f85e96 in RenderThread::run (this=0x8176010) at /home/kde-devel/kdesvn/kdebase/workspace/plasma/containments/desktop/renderthread.cpp:84
#4  0xb6894327 in QThreadPrivate::start (arg=0x8176010)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qthread_unix.cpp:190
#5  0xb682d46b in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#6  0xb5c736de in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 3 (Thread -1319249008 (LWP 28596)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b6831676 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b6894a06 in QWaitCondition::wait (this=0x874c30c, mutex=0x874c308, time=4294967295)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qwaitcondition_unix.cpp:88
#3  0xb2f85e96 in RenderThread::run (this=0x874c300) at /home/kde-devel/kdesvn/kdebase/workspace/plasma/containments/desktop/renderthread.cpp:84
#4  0xb6894327 in QThreadPrivate::start (arg=0x874c300)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qthread_unix.cpp:190
#5  0xb682d46b in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#6  0xb5c736de in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 2 (Thread -1340421232 (LWP 28608)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b5c6c2a1 in select () from /lib/tls/i686/cmov/libc.so.6
#2  0xb6950e0f in QProcessManager::run (this=0x80810f8) at /home/kde-devel/kdesvn/qt-copy/src/corelib/io/qprocess_unix.cpp:307
#3  0xb6894327 in QThreadPrivate::start (arg=0x80810f8)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qthread_unix.cpp:190
#4  0xb682d46b in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#5  0xb5c736de in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 1 (Thread -1263552800 (LWP 28347)):
[KCrash Handler]
#6  QMutex::lock (this=0x2b) at /home/kde-devel/kdesvn/qt-copy/src/corelib/thread/qmutex.cpp:153
#7  0xb696cf0c in QCoreApplication::postEvent (receiver=0x8dd8098, event=0x9107a60, priority=0) at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qcoreapplication.cpp:971
#8  0xb696d1ac in QCoreApplication::postEvent (receiver=0x8dd8098, event=0x9107a60) at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qcoreapplication.cpp:925
#9  0xb69797f4 in QObject::deleteLater (this=0x8dd8098) at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qobject.cpp:2041
#10 0xb7e01452 in Plasma::ContainmentPrivate::toggleDesktopImmutability (this=0x8163a80) at /home/kde-devel/kdesvn/kdebase/workspace/libs/plasma/containment.cpp:1079
#11 0xb7e098a6 in Plasma::Containment::qt_metacall (this=0x8175f80, _c=QMetaObject::InvokeMetaMethod, _id=43, _a=0xbf9f62fc)
    at /home/kde-devel/kdesvn/build/kdebase/workspace/libs/plasma/containment.moc:130
#12 0xb2f7694a in DefaultDesktop::qt_metacall (this=0x8175f80, _c=QMetaObject::InvokeMetaMethod, _id=43, _a=0xbf9f62fc)
    at /home/kde-devel/kdesvn/build/kdebase/workspace/plasma/containments/desktop/desktop.moc:75
#13 0xb697caea in QMetaObject::activate (sender=0x811e050, from_signal_index=<value optimized out>, to_signal_index=6, argv=<value optimized out>)
    at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qobject.cpp:3007
#14 0xb697cdf0 in QMetaObject::activate (sender=0x811e050, m=0xb67ba3f8, from_local_signal_index=1, to_local_signal_index=2, argv=0xbf9f62fc)
    at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qobject.cpp:3100
#15 0xb619d3c1 in QAction::triggered (this=0x811e050, _t1=false) at .moc/release-shared/moc_qaction.cpp:216
#16 0xb619e37f in QAction::activate (this=0x811e050, event=QAction::Trigger)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qaction.cpp:1119
#17 0xb652ca5d in QMenuPrivate::activateAction (this=0x90f6808, action=0x811e050, action_e=QAction::Trigger, self=true) at /home/kde-devel/kdesvn/qt-copy/src/gui/widgets/qmenu.cpp:1005
#18 0xb652f07f in QMenu::mouseReleaseEvent (this=0xbf9f7260, e=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/gui/widgets/qmenu.cpp:2160
#19 0xb701cf8c in KMenu::mouseReleaseEvent (this=0xbf9f7260, e=0xbf9f6a8c) at /home/kde-devel/kdesvn/kdelibs/kdeui/widgets/kmenu.cpp:452
#20 0xb61f1cb3 in QWidget::event (this=0xbf9f7260, event=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qwidget.cpp:6927
#21 0xb652a68f in QMenu::event (this=0xbf9f7260, e=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/gui/widgets/qmenu.cpp:2256
#22 0xb61a375f in QApplicationPrivate::notify_helper (this=0x807b768, receiver=0xbf9f7260, e=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qapplication.cpp:3772
#23 0xb61aa291 in QApplication::notify (this=0x8062648, receiver=0xbf9f7260, e=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qapplication.cpp:3501
#24 0xb6f468fa in KApplication::notify (this=0x8062648, receiver=0xbf9f7260, event=0xbf9f6a8c) at /home/kde-devel/kdesvn/kdelibs/kdeui/kernel/kapplication.cpp:311
#25 0xb696c469 in QCoreApplication::notifyInternal (this=0x8062648, receiver=0xbf9f7260, event=0xbf9f6a8c) at /home/kde-devel/kdesvn/qt-copy/src/corelib/kernel/qcoreapplication.cpp:583
#26 0xb61a9880 in QApplicationPrivate::sendMouseEvent (receiver=0xbf9f7260, event=0xbf9f6a8c, alienWidget=0x0, nativeWidget=0xbf9f7260, buttonDown=0xb67d6b50, lastMouseReceiver=@0xb67d6b54)
    at ../../include/QtCore/../../../../qt-copy/src/corelib/kernel/qcoreapplication.h:218
#27 0xb6204e89 in QETWidget::translateMouseEvent (this=0xbf9f7260, event=0xbf9f6f48)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qapplication_x11.cpp:4067
#28 0xb62045c6 in QApplication::x11ProcessEvent (this=0x8062648, event=0xbf9f6f48)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qapplication_x11.cpp:3133
#29 0xb62296c4 in x11EventSourceDispatch (s=0x8080ed8, callback=0, user_data=0x0) at /home/kde-devel/kdesvn/qt-copy/src/gui/kernel/qguieventdispatcher_glib.cpp:148
#30 0xb5a3611c in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#31 0xb5a3955f in ?? () from /usr/lib/libglib-2.0.so.0
#32 0x08080298 in ?? ()
#33 0x00000000 in ?? ()
Comment 1 Aaron J. Seigo 2008-07-16 20:16:24 UTC
*** Bug has been marked as fixed ***.
Comment 2 SlashDevDsp 2008-07-17 04:04:58 UTC
wow, that was a very quick bug fix